Yes, they’re the same city. In 1995, the state of Maharashtra (of which Mumbai is the capital) declared that ‘Bombay’ would be officially renamed ‘Mumbai’. This change came about due to the Shiv Sena political party’s campaign for a more Marathi-speaking name for the city.
Mumbai features a nice mix of traditional charm with old-world architecture alongside contemporary skyscrapers as well as historical sites and cultural landmarks. It’s known as the commercial capital of India and offers visitors a range of art, history, culture, food, theater, and nightlife opportunities to explore.
The current estimated population of Mumbai City in 2023 is 17,159,000, while the Mumbai metro population is estimated at 25,368,000.
The four primary languages currently spoken throughout the Mumbai area of India are Marathi, Hindi, English, and Gujarati.

New Delhi is India’s vibrant, multi-faceted capital. The city is a part of the larger Delhi region and serves as the seat of all three branches of the Government of India. The sprawling metropolis known for its wide, tree-lined boulevards and is home to several beautiful parks and gardens, like the Lodhi Gardens and the Mughal-era garden Shalimar Bagh. It’s also famous for its bustling markets and numerous monuments, such as the Red Fort, Qutub Minar, and Humayun’s Tomb, which are also UNESCO World Heritage Sites. The rugged landscapes of the Outer Hebrides, off Scotland’s west coast, may be sparsely populated, but there’s a deep human history here, from ancient stone circles to traditional Gaelic culture. These interconnected islands have shaped a distinct way of life, not just in the Harris Tweed and whisky distilleries that travellers encounter, but also in the daily routines of remote fishing communities. Spanning over 150 miles, this island chain is stitched together by causeway, bridge, road and boat, meaning visitors can pick their own method — car, bike, bus or ferry — to make the most of this extraordinary destination.
